Hyundai Tucson: Exterior Lights / High Beam Operation

To turn on the high beam headlight, push the lever away from you. The lever returns to its original position.

The high beam indicator illuminates when the headlight high beams are switched on.

To turn off the high beam headlight, pull the lever toward you. The low beams turn on.

WARNING

Do not use high beam when there are other vehicles approaching you. Using high beam may obstruct the other driver’s vision.

To flash the high beam headlight, pull the lever toward you, then release the lever. The high beams remain ON as long as you hold the lever.
